Choosing the Right Difficulty on the Fly

Chicken Road offers four difficulty brackets: Easy (24 steps), Medium (22 steps), Hard (20 steps), and Hardcore (15 steps). Short‑session players often start easy to build rhythm, then switch up as confidence grows.

If you’re in a hurry and want a quick win, pick Easy—longer survival means more chances to cash out early before the multiplier spikes too high. For those craving a thrill within seconds, Hardcore offers a rapid climb to potentially huge payouts.

  • Easy – 24 steps, lower risk.
  • Medium – 22 steps, balanced risk/reward.
  • Hard – 20 steps, higher multipliers.
  • Hardcore – 15 steps, maximum risk.
